Magazine rankings rate Atlantic Links

The six premier links courses in south west England, known as England’s Atlantic Links, have maintained their strong presence in the latest course rankings compiled by Golf Monthly. In the publication’s ‘UK & Ireland’s Top 100 Golf Courses 2015/16’ just released, Somerset’s Burnham & Berrow (pictured) ranks most highly amongst the Atlantic Links championship courses at number 33, up four places from 37th spot two years ago.

Burnham is closely followed by Saunton’s East Course at 35 (up from 39) and St Enodoc’s Church Course in Cornwall which has continued its rise up the rankings to 36th from 41st position. The other three Atlantic Links courses also feature well inside the top 100 with Saunton West in at number 61, Royal North Devon (known also as Westward Ho!) placed in 72nd position and Cornwall’s Trevose in 77th spot.

Karen Drake, Secretary at Burnham & Berrow stated, “All the clubs in the Atlantic Links are of course delighted to feature so prominently in the new Golf Monthly rankings which are after all produced ‘by golfers, for golfers’. Indeed these rankings prove that the Atlantic Links is a genuine and credible alternative to the links golf available in both Scotland and Ireland.” More at: www.atlantic-links.co.uk
